The results from monster.co.uk shows that only one in 10 believe good results got them where they are today.
Commenting on the findings, Mike Jones, director general of the Foundation for Management Education, said: "I remember when A levels used to be the hardest exams you would ever do, but now more and more people are going on to higher education and it is not so much of a meritocracy."
He added: "Qualifications don't last forever and even an MBA has a shelf life. I think that a degree has become a prerequisite to getting into a lot of jobs and recruiters will be looking for something additional to this."
